What movie in 1986 has 11 Oscar nominations and won none?
The Color Purple
The Color Purple and Out of Africa led all nominees with eleven each. Winners were announced during the awards ceremony on March 24, 1986. With its 11 nominations and zero wins, The Color Purple joined The Turning Point as the most nominated films in Oscar history without a single win.
What movies were nominated for best picture in 1986?
Best Picture
- Out of Africa. Sydney Pollack, Producer.
- The Color Purple. Steven Spielberg, Kathleen Kennedy, Frank Marshall and Quincy Jones, Producers.
- Kiss of the Spider Woman. David Weisman, Producer.
- Prizzi’s Honor. John Foreman, Producer.
- Witness. Edward S. Feldman, Producer.
What year did Platoon win best picture?
Platoon, American war film, released in 1986, that was written and directed by Oliver Stone and was regarded by many critics as one of the best of the movies about the Vietnam War. Platoon won the Academy Award for best picture and the Golden Globe Award for best drama.
Who was nominated for best actress in 1987?
Actress in a Leading Role
- Marlee Matlin. Children of a Lesser God.
- Jane Fonda. The Morning After.
- Sissy Spacek. Crimes of the Heart.
- Kathleen Turner. Peggy Sue Got Married.
- Sigourney Weaver. Aliens.

How many Oscars did Platoon receive?
The film was a box office success upon its release, grossing $138.5 million domestically against its $6 million budget. The film was nominated for eight Academy Awards at the 59th Academy Awards, and won four including Best Picture, Best Director for Stone, Best Sound, and Best Film Editing.
Who was nominated for best actress in 1988?
Actress in a Leading Role
- Cher. Moonstruck.
- Glenn Close. Fatal Attraction.
- Holly Hunter. Broadcast News.
- Sally Kirkland. Anna.
- Meryl Streep. Ironweed.
